What is Subset?

A set A is a subset of another set B if all of its elements are also members of the set B. In other words, set A is found within set B. The subset relationship is denoted by symbol  A⊂B.

Example of Subset:

For example, if set A has {1,2} and set B has {1,2,3,} then A is a subset of B since elements of set A are present in set B.

What is a Proper subset?

A is a proper subset of B if and only if, every element of A in B, but there is at least one element of B that is not in A.

What is Improper subset?

Improper subset is a subset containing every elements of the other set.

Example of Proper subset:

A = { 1, 3, 5 } And B = {1, 2 3, 5,}

A set is “A” subset of “B” because all the elements of set “A” are in “B” but there is an element 2 of B which is not in A.

Example of Improper subset:

Let A = { 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10}

Subsets of the Set A are:

B= { 1, 2, 3, 4}

C= { 6, 7, 8, 9}

D = { 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10}

now, B and C sets are proper subsets while set D contains all the elements of the original set.
